Now its the Shallow SWD’s That are Causing “Widespread" Contamination Problems in Permian

Over the past five years, the Texas Railroad Commission (RRC) has put increasing restrictions on deep well wastewater injection due to earthquake incidences, so oil/gas producers began injecting more into shallow formations.  However, the RRC now concedes that this latter practice is causing “widespread” increases in underground pressure, “breaching wells and causing the ground to swell and rupture, threatening to contaminate drinking water supplies…” EcoVAP stands ready to reduce these wastewater volumes by >90% via its low-cost, biomimicry-based natural evaporation technology.
